WebThe Franz cell consists of two chambers separated by a membrane, which can be human skin. The test product is applied to the skin through the top chamber and samples can be taken for analysis from the bottom chamber which is fluid-filled. Such studies have confirmed that parabens can be absorbed through human skin as intact esters [37]. WebResults: Immediately after different times tape stripping, the amount of cuticle cells residues and the microvascular images were different. In skin barrier repairing process, the scab forming time observed under dermoscopy was day 14, day 7, and day 3 on 30 times, 35 times, and 40 times stripped skin, respectively.
